In 2017, 3M implemented Oracle Marketing Cloud (Eloqua) on their website. Oracle Marketing Cloud (Eloqua) is deployed as Marketing Automation to support 3M marketing and digital engagement functions. The deployment leverages core Oracle Marketing Cloud (Eloqua) capabilities including email campaign management, web form capture, landing page hosting, behavioral tracking via site instrumentation, audience segmentation, and campaign orchestration. Configurations emphasized reusable template libraries, email deliverability controls, and automated nurture workflows consistent with Marketing Automation functional workflows. Oracle Marketing Cloud (Eloqua) is instrumented on the 3M public website to capture visitor interactions and trigger behavior based engagement flows. Operational ownership is within the marketing organization, focused on demand generation, digital campaign execution, and product marketing digital engagement. Governance practices implemented alongside the platform include centralized campaign and asset governance, template and segment management, and privacy aware consent handling to align web capture with marketing processes. Ongoing use centers on campaign orchestration, segmentation strategy, and web to lead capture practices using Oracle Marketing Cloud (Eloqua).

FAQ - APPS RUN THE WORLD Oracle Marketing Cloud (Eloqua) Coverage

Oracle Marketing Cloud (Eloqua) is a Marketing Automation solution from Oracle.

Companies worldwide use Oracle Marketing Cloud (Eloqua), from small firms to large enterprises across 21+ industries.

Organizations such as CVS Health, Cigna Healthcare, Samsung Electronics South Korea and Samsung Electronics are recorded users of Oracle Marketing Cloud (Eloqua) for Marketing Automation.

Companies using Oracle Marketing Cloud (Eloqua) are most concentrated in Healthcare, Insurance and Manufacturing, with adoption spanning over 21 industries.

Companies using Oracle Marketing Cloud (Eloqua) are most concentrated in United States and South Korea, with adoption tracked across 195 countries worldwide. This global distribution highlights the popularity of Oracle Marketing Cloud (Eloqua) across Americas, EMEA, and APAC.

Companies using Oracle Marketing Cloud (Eloqua) range from small businesses with 0-100 employees - 28.83%, to mid-sized firms with 101-1,000 employees - 33.53%, large organizations with 1,001-10,000 employees - 27.29%, and global enterprises with 10,000+ employees - 10.35%.
